Key Responsibilities:
Collect and label lab specimens in accordance with hospital protocolsSupport nurses and physicians during GI procedures such as endoscopies and colonoscopiesPrepare patients and equipment for diagnostic proceduresRetrieve necessary supplies and equipment for GI examsDocument clinical findings and complete hospital forms accuratelyMonitor and record vital signs, weight, and other patient metricsAssist with patient admissions, discharges, and transfersPerform follow-up tasks as directed by clinical staffEssential Skills:
Medical assisting and patient care experienceProficiency in Electronic Health Records (EHR), especially EpicPrior authorization processingExperience working with high-touch patient populations (e.g., Pain Management, Behavioral Health, GI)Ability to room 15–20 patients per dayQualifications:
High School Diploma or GEDCompletion of a Medical Assistant ProgramAmerican Heart Association BLS certificationMinimum 2 years of experience as a Medical AssistantAt least 1 year of prior authorization experience2+ years working with Electronic Medical RecordsPrevious experience in gastroenterology or a related specialty (preferred)Bilingual in Spanish (preferred)Work Environment:
